To update on my servo fuse blowing, I changed the fuse and it blew quickly so started to troubleshoot. The guillotine servo seemed a little tight so I took all that apart (video was very helpful) and reassembled and have played several games without it blowing. Frequently when the ball goes behind the drop target to go into crypt multiball, another ball does not go into the shooter lane and launch, effectively ending your game. Any thoughts on why this would happen? Its kinda hard to get this machine dialed in

#7443 1 year ago

Thanks, I am hoping my balls are magnetized but going to check the optos as well. Could my potentially magnetized balls cause switch problems with the monster as well?

#7446 1 year ago

I think it was the magnetized balls. I played about 6 games and have not had an issue. Even the lower magnet worked properly most of the time.
